Forum\View\Article\ArticleHtmlView::prepareData PHP Method

prepareData() protected method

prepareData
protected prepareData ( Windwalker\Data\Data $data ) : void
$data Windwalker\Data\Data
return void
    protected function prepareData($data)
    {
        parent::prepareData($data);
        $desc = $data->item->body;
        $desc = Utf8String::substr(strip_tags($desc), 0, 150);
        HtmlHeader::addMetadata('description', $desc, true);
        HtmlHeader::addOpenGraph('og:title', HtmlHeader::getPageTitle(), true);
        HtmlHeader::addOpenGraph('og:description', $desc, true);
        HtmlHeader::addOpenGraph('og:image', $data->item->image, true);
    }
ArticleHtmlView